West Palm Beach Condo Sets Record After Selling for $21 Million

A condo in the coveted The Bristol West Palm Beach condominium set a record after selling for $21 million, the highest price ever paid for a single unit, which was double what it previously traded for in 2019. The unit at  

1100 S Flagler Drive #1901 was sold by Samantha Curry with Douglas Elliman, who has sold close to $400M at The Bristol. Steve Hall with Compass repped the buyer. 

The corner residence was designed by Marc Michaels at The Bristol and features 5,544 square feet of interior plus a 1,500 wraparound terrace. The four-bedroom unit has an office and a chic contemporary design with views of the ocean and Intracoastal. Its 11-ft floor-to-ceiling glass surrounds the entire residence. The condo also features a one-of-a-kind entertaining bar and a state-of-the-art kitchen with top-of-the-line Gaggenau appliances, Snaidero Italian cabinetry, and a 100-bottle Sub Zero wine refrigerator. Additional highlights include immaculate built-ins, bespoke furnishings, and an enhanced Crestron Smart Home technology with automated control of lighting, shades, sheers, music and thermostat. 

The Bristol offers five-star amenities, including an on-site professional concierge, two spas, a beauty salon, a waterfront fitness center, a 75-ft resort-style swimming pool, a club lounge and a dog park.
